<div><br></div><div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Mon, 4 Mar 2019 at 20:33, Amar Tumballi Suryanarayan &lt;<a href="mailto:atumball@redhat.com">atumball@redhat.com</a>&gt; wrote:<br></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">Thanks to those who participated.<br>
<br>
Update at present:<br>
<br>
We found 3 blocker bugs in upgrade scenarios, and hence have marked release<br>
as pending upon them. We will keep these lists updated about progress.</blockquote><div dir="auto"><br></div><div dir="auto">I’d like to clarify that upgrade testing is blocked. So just fixing these test blocker(s) isn’t enough to call release-6 green. We need to continue and finish the rest of the upgrade tests once the respective bugs are fixed.</div><div dir="auto"><br></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><br>
<br>
-Amar<br>
<br>
On Mon, Feb 25, 2019 at 11:41 PM Amar Tumballi Suryanarayan &lt;<br>
<a href="mailto:atumball@redhat.com" target="_blank">atumball@redhat.com</a>&gt; wrote:<br>
<br>
&gt; Hi all,<br>
&gt;<br>
&gt; We are calling out our users, and developers to contribute in validating<br>
&gt; ‘glusterfs-6.0rc’ build in their usecase. Specially for the cases of<br>
&gt; upgrade, stability, and performance.<br>
&gt;<br>
&gt; Some of the key highlights of the release are listed in release-notes<br>
&gt; draft<br>
&gt; &lt;<a href="https://github.com/gluster/glusterfs/blob/release-6/doc/release-notes/6.0.md" rel="noreferrer" target="_blank">https://github.com/gluster/glusterfs/blob/release-6/doc/release-notes/6.0.md</a>&gt;.<br>
&gt; Please note that there are some of the features which are being dropped out<br>
&gt; of this release, and hence making sure your setup is not going to have an<br>
&gt; issue is critical. Also the default lru-limit option in fuse mount for<br>
&gt; Inodes should help to control the memory usage of client processes. All the<br>
&gt; good reason to give it a shot in your test setup.<br>
&gt;<br>
&gt; If you are developer using gfapi interface to integrate with other<br>
&gt; projects, you also have some signature changes, so please make sure your<br>
&gt; project would work with latest release. Or even if you are using a project<br>
&gt; which depends on gfapi, report the error with new RPMs (if any). We will<br>
&gt; help fix it.<br>
&gt;<br>
&gt; As part of test days, we want to focus on testing the latest upcoming<br>
&gt; release i.e. GlusterFS-6, and one or the other gluster volunteers would be<br>
&gt; there on #gluster channel on freenode to assist the people. Some of the key<br>
&gt; things we are looking as bug reports are:<br>
&gt;<br>
&gt;    -<br>
&gt;<br>
&gt;    See if upgrade from your current version to 6.0rc is smooth, and works<br>
&gt;    as documented.<br>
&gt;    - Report bugs in process, or in documentation if you find mismatch.<br>
&gt;    -<br>
&gt;<br>
&gt;    Functionality is all as expected for your usecase.<br>
&gt;    - No issues with actual application you would run on production etc.<br>
&gt;    -<br>
&gt;<br>
&gt;    Performance has not degraded in your usecase.<br>
&gt;    - While we have added some performance options to the code, not all of<br>
&gt;       them are turned on, as they have to be done based on usecases.<br>
&gt;       - Make sure the default setup is at least same as your current<br>
&gt;       version<br>
&gt;       - Try out few options mentioned in release notes (especially,<br>
&gt;       --auto-invalidation=no) and see if it helps performance.<br>
&gt;    -<br>
&gt;<br>
&gt;    While doing all the above, check below:<br>
&gt;    - see if the log files are making sense, and not flooding with some<br>
&gt;       “for developer only” type of messages.<br>
&gt;       - get ‘profile info’ output from old and now, and see if there is<br>
&gt;       anything which is out of normal expectation. Check with us on the numbers.<br>
&gt;       - get a ‘statedump’ when there are some issues. Try to make sense<br>
&gt;       of it, and raise a bug if you don’t understand it completely.<br>
&gt;<br>
&gt;<br>
&gt; &lt;<a href="https://hackmd.io/YB60uRCMQRC90xhNt4r6gA?both#Process-expected-on-test-days" rel="noreferrer" target="_blank">https://hackmd.io/YB60uRCMQRC90xhNt4r6gA?both#Process-expected-on-test-days</a>&gt;Process<br>
&gt; expected on test days.<br>
&gt;<br>
&gt;    -<br>
&gt;<br>
&gt;    We have a tracker bug<br>
&gt;    &lt;<a href="https://bugzilla.redhat.com/show_bug.cgi?id=glusterfs-6.0" rel="noreferrer" target="_blank">https://bugzilla.redhat.com/show_bug.cgi?id=glusterfs-6.0</a>&gt;[0]<br>
&gt;    - We will attach all the ‘blocker’ bugs to this bug.<br>
&gt;    -<br>
&gt;<br>
&gt;    Use this link to report bugs, so that we have more metadata around<br>
&gt;    given bugzilla.<br>
&gt;    - Click Here<br>
&gt;       &lt;<a href="https://bugzilla.redhat.com/enter_bug.cgi?blocked=1672818&amp;bug_severity=high&amp;component=core&amp;priority=high&amp;product=GlusterFS&amp;status_whiteboard=gluster-test-day&amp;version=6" rel="noreferrer" target="_blank">https://bugzilla.redhat.com/enter_bug.cgi?blocked=1672818&amp;bug_severity=high&amp;component=core&amp;priority=high&amp;product=GlusterFS&amp;status_whiteboard=gluster-test-day&amp;version=6</a>&gt;<br>
&gt;       [1]<br>
&gt;    -<br>
&gt;<br>
&gt;    The test cases which are to be tested are listed here in this sheet<br>
&gt;    &lt;<a href="https://docs.google.com/spreadsheets/d/1AS-tDiJmAr9skK535MbLJGe_RfqDQ3j1abX1wtjwpL4/edit?usp=sharing" rel="noreferrer" target="_blank">https://docs.google.com/spreadsheets/d/1AS-tDiJmAr9skK535MbLJGe_RfqDQ3j1abX1wtjwpL4/edit?usp=sharing</a>&gt;[2],<br>
&gt;    please add, update, and keep it up-to-date to reduce duplicate efforts</blockquote></div></div>-- <br><div dir="ltr" class="gmail_signature" data-smartmail="gmail_signature">- Atin (atinm)</div>